Why Your Resume Matters More Than Ever Before

In 2025, the hiring process is more competitive and automated than ever. Employers use applicant tracking systems (ATS) to filter resumes, meaning only those with the right keywords make it to human recruiters. Moreover, global competition and remote work opportunities mean you're not just competing locally but with talent worldwide.

A strong resume is more than a list of your qualifications. It’s a strategic document that highlights your skills, achievements, and potential. By following these resume writing tips, you can ensure your resume stands out in the crowded job market.

3. Focus on Achievements, Not Responsibilities

Employers are interested in what you’ve accomplished, not just what you were tasked to do. Use action verbs and quantify your achievements wherever possible.

Instead of:
“Managed a team of sales associates.”

Say:
“Led a team of 10 sales associates to exceed quarterly sales targets by 25%.”

Common Mistakes to Avoid

1. Grammatical Errors and Typos

Errors in your resume can make you appear careless. Proofread multiple times or use tools like Grammarly.

2. Using Generic Descriptions

Avoid vague statements like “Excellent communication skills.” Be specific about how your skills have made an impact.

3. Irrelevant Information

Focus on experiences and skills relevant to the job you’re applying for. Hobbies and personal details, unless they add value, should be left out.
